What is Emsculpt?
Emsculpt is a cutting-edge technology that uses high-intensity focused electromagnetic (HIFEM) energy to stimulate muscle contractions. These intense contractions result in the strengthening and toning of the targeted muscles, effectively building muscle and reducing fat. The treatment is FDA-approved and can be used on various areas of the body, including the abdomen, buttocks, and thighs.
Is Emsculpt Painful?
One of the major benefits of Emsculpt is that it is a relatively painless procedure. While the muscle contractions can be intense, most patients report feeling only a slight tingling or pulling sensation during the treatment. The experience is often described as similar to a deep tissue massage or an intense workout. Some individuals may experience mild discomfort or muscle soreness in the treated areas after the procedure, but this typically subsides within a day or two.
How Effective is Emsculpt?
Emsculpt has been shown to be an effective body contouring treatment in numerous clinical studies. The HIFEM technology used in Emsculpt can induce up to 20,000 muscle contractions during a single 30-minute session, leading to significant muscle building and fat reduction. Patients typically see a noticeable improvement in muscle tone and a reduction in fat after a series of four treatments, spaced out over several weeks.

FAQs about Emsculpt in Salisbury
Q: How many Emsculpt treatments do I need to see results?
A: Most patients see optimal results after a series of four Emsculpt treatments, spaced out over several weeks.
Q: Is Emsculpt safe for everyone?
A: Emsculpt is generally safe for most healthy adults, but it may not be suitable for individuals with certain medical conditions or who are pregnant or breastfeeding. Your provider will evaluate your health history to ensure Emsculpt is a safe and appropriate treatment for you.
Q: How long do the results from Emsculpt last?
A: The results from Emsculpt can last for several months, but maintaining a healthy lifestyle and regular exercise is important for prolonging the effects.
Q: What areas of the body can be treated with Emsculpt?
A: Emsculpt can be used to target the abdomen, buttocks, thighs, and other areas to build muscle and reduce fat.
